bigsheeper
dd77e08b9e
[skip ci] Add comment for hasCollection ( #9660 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-11 19:04:37 +08:00
bigsheeper
1b128c3fbf
[skip ci] Add comment for getCollectionByIDPrivate ( #9659 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-11 19:02:45 +08:00
bigsheeper
ba998b1673
[skip ci] Add comment for hasCollectionPrivate ( #9661 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-11 18:56:37 +08:00
bigsheeper
cc1801fa98
Add comment for removeCollectionPrivate ( #9584 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-09 18:41:32 +08:00
bigsheeper
1b3a7b129b
Add comment for removeCollection ( #9583 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-09 18:39:48 +08:00
bigsheeper
5865ead978
[skip ci] Add comment for getCollectionByID ( #9585 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-09 18:33:32 +08:00
bigsheeper
edea91ae6e
[skip ci] Add comment for addColllection ( #9523 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-08 23:53:25 +08:00
bigsheeper
d7b29c059c
[skip ci] Add comment for getCollectionIDs ( #9435 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-08 06:47:15 +08:00
bigsheeper
8696a37fe6
[skip ci] Add comment for printReplica ( #9434 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-08 06:45:25 +08:00
bigsheeper
44622622f6
[skip ci] Add comment for getSegmentsMemSize ( #9433 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-10-08 06:43:26 +08:00
bigsheeper
9d6c95bf25
Add cacheSize to prevent OOM in query node ( #8765 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-09-28 22:24:03 +08:00
bigsheeper
11c65dc2b3
Add comment for collection replica ( #8147 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-09-18 18:15:51 +08:00
bigsheeper
bc1f39bb55
Remove deprecated replica interface in query node ( #7908 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-09-15 10:09:53 +08:00
bigsheeper
691e4c5bc9
Use definitional type instead of raw type ( #7797 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-09-14 10:25:26 +08:00
bigsheeper
4123deef9e
Return error message in grpc.LoadSegment in query node ( #6908 )
...
* return load error
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* init streaming meta in loadSegment
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* fix excluded init
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* improve impl
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-08-03 22:01:27 +08:00
bigsheeper
e8ea8b51d5
improve query node log ( #6897 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-07-31 10:47:22 +08:00
Cai Yudong
a992dcf6a8
Support query return vector output field ( #6570 )
...
* improve code readibility
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* add offset in RetrieveResults
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* add VectorFieldInfo into Segment struct
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* add new interface for query vector
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* update load vector field logic
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* update load vector field logic
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* fill in field name in query result
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* add FieldId into FieldData
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* add fillVectorOutputFieldsIfNeeded
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* update data_codec_test.go
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* add DeserializeFieldData
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* realize query return vector output field
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* fix static-check
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
* disable query vector case
Signed-off-by: yudong.cai <yudong.cai@zilliz.com>
2021-07-16 17:19:55 +08:00
xige-16
7039fb7c82
Fix the problem of stuck after loadBalance and loadFieldData error ( #5960 )
...
* delete nodeInfo after nodeDown
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* fix load balance can's stop
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* fix load field data error
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* contiue task loop after error in queryService
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-06-22 14:10:09 +08:00
bigsheeper
bbd8a7e13a
Add released partitions and fix search error in empty partition ( #5893 )
...
* rename flowgraphType to loadType
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* add load type and released partitions
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* filter released partition
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-06-19 18:38:07 +08:00
xige-16
e4c51aae36
Add recovery logic for querynode and queryservice ( #5843 )
...
* merge milvus/recovery2
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* add recovery logic in queryservice
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* debug smoke case
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* add etcd to querynode
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* fix release partition error
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* fix load balance error
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* debug querynode down and recovery
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* add log
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* fix showCollection
Signed-off-by: xige-16 <xi.ge@zilliz.com>
* skip smoke test search without insert
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-06-19 11:45:09 +08:00
xige-16
97049ce293
use dataservice's getRecoveryInfo to get load and watch info ( #5790 )
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-06-16 11:09:56 +08:00
bigsheeper
58bf92a407
Add vChannel,pChannel in query node and get vChannel from master in query service ( #5784 )
...
* add vChannel,pChannel in query node and get vChannel from master in query service
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-06-15 20:06:10 +08:00
bigsheeper
cdbc6d2c94
Refactor query node and query service ( #5751 )
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
Co-authored-by: xige-16 <xi.ge@zilliz.com>
Co-authored-by: yudong.cai <yudong.cai@zilliz.com>
2021-06-15 12:41:40 +08:00
bigsheeper
8aae0f7cc9
Refactor flow graph and load/watchDML in query node ( #5682 )
...
* Refactor flow graph and load/watchDML in query node
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-06-09 11:37:55 +08:00
bigsheeper
03f90ff28c
refactor collection replica and add tsafe replica in querynode ( #5475 )
...
* refactor collection replica and add tsafe replica in querynode
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* static check
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* static check2
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* code format
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-05-28 15:40:32 +08:00
xige-16
fce792b8bf
Add historical and streaming module in querynode ( #5469 )
...
* add historical and streaming
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* fix GetSegmentInfo
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
* pass regression test
Signed-off-by: xige-16 <xi.ge@zilliz.com>
Co-authored-by: bigsheeper <yihao.dai@zilliz.com>
2021-05-28 10:26:30 +08:00
Xiangyu Wang
82ccd4cec0
Rename module ( #4988 )
...
* Rename module
Signed-off-by: Xiangyu Wang <xiangyu.wang@zilliz.com>
2021-04-22 14:45:57 +08:00
bigsheeper
71b8f309b2
Add licence to query node and query service
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-04-19 13:47:10 +08:00
xige-16
332b14c915
Delete querynode’s redundant load IO
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-04-07 18:29:19 +08:00
bigsheeper
dfb68a7e46
Remove unused segment
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-03-25 16:08:08 -05:00
FluorineDog
f39dcdb8f3
Support error code in segcore
...
Signed-off-by: FluorineDog <guilin.gou@zilliz.com>
2021-03-26 16:18:30 +08:00
zhenshan.cao
c2734fa55f
Fix bug and enchance system
...
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
2021-03-22 16:36:10 +08:00
xige-16
8a5c039137
Fix search error when running single node
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-03-12 19:23:06 +08:00
godchen
f3649f0419
Refactor interface and proto
...
Signed-off-by: godchen <qingxiang.chen@zilliz.com>
2021-03-12 14:22:09 +08:00
xige-16
09ae985daa
Fix wrong error code in master_service_test.go
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-03-10 22:06:22 +08:00
XuanYang-cn
8567679888
Check enableIndex before load index
...
Signed-off-by: XuanYang-cn <xuan.yang@zilliz.com>
2021-03-10 14:51:00 +08:00
quicksilver
74154a11a4
Fix deploy error during regression stage
...
Signed-off-by: quicksilver <zhifeng.zhang@zilliz.com>
2021-03-05 16:52:45 +08:00
sunby
ddddd65d10
Delete internal/errors package
...
Signed-off-by: sunby <bingyi.sun@zilliz.com>
2021-03-05 10:15:27 +08:00
bigsheeper
447a15207e
Add zap log to query node
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-03-05 09:21:35 +08:00
bigsheeper
08a020798e
Release collection and partitions
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-02-24 17:24:51 +08:00
xige-16
d5379a82a8
Fix load binlog error when segment not flushed
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-02-23 14:13:33 +08:00
xige-16
f62078c027
Fix crash error when search
...
Signed-off-by: xige-16 <xi.ge@zilliz.com>
2021-02-20 10:14:03 +08:00
sunby
5769c000a1
Find failed python tests and add skip mark "r0.3-test"
...
Signed-off-by: sunby <bingyi.sun@zilliz.com>
2021-02-19 15:37:04 +08:00
bigsheeper
d8f41db823
Fix search crash error
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-02-19 13:56:01 +08:00
bigsheeper
12b2eaf196
Rename apis
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-02-07 21:26:03 +08:00
zhenshan.cao
1ba8e2448f
Add tsLoop for indexservice
...
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
2021-02-07 18:38:58 +08:00
bigsheeper
a64c831ed9
Fix segment replacement bug
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-02-07 18:37:18 +08:00
bigsheeper
b07b2484dc
Fix error when loading
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-02-07 10:29:58 +08:00
bigsheeper
e9ee9a273e
Refactor load service and check insertion binLog periodically
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-02-06 11:35:35 +08:00
bigsheeper
1578c13224
Refactor collection replica
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2021-02-05 10:53:11 +08:00